Nabi call-up vs Shami omission: India's rigid stance exposed

India picked Auqib Nabi to replace injured Jasprit Bumrah in the Sri Lanka Test squad, passing over Mohammed Shami despite a strong domestic season.

Jasprit Bumrah's knee injury—picked up during last month's ODI series—knocked him out of India's two-match Test tour to Sri Lanka. In his place, India named Auqib Nabi, a 29-year-old pacer from Jammu and Kashmir who's taken 104 Ranji wickets over two seasons and six more for India A in Sri Lanka itself.

The call leaves Mohammed Shami on the sidelines. Shami's had a strong domestic season and carries Test pedigree, but India's selectors have made it clear they're building for depth across cycles rather than plugging gaps with proven names. Nabi becomes the primary swing and seam option in the pace attack for this tour.
